Bill Penzey Bio: The Story Behind the Numbers

Bill Penzey is a chronicler of everyday American life, turning roadside conversations and ordinary moments into a distinctively candid brand of storytelling. His work blends memoir, cultural observation, and grassroots political insight, positioning him as a relatable voice for readers who value authenticity over polished detachment.

Across books, live tours, and social channels, Penzey builds a narrative universe where personal stories double as social commentary and political reflection. This article outlines his career arc, communication style, and the questions audiences most often ask.

Early Life and Formative Influences

Childhood and Geographic Roots

Growing up in environments that emphasized direct talk and practical experience shaped Penzey’s inclination to treat ordinary dialogue as material for deeper reflection. These early years established a template for valuing lived experience over abstract theory.

Career Path Before the Spotlight

Before becoming a full time narrator of American life, Penzey moved through jobs and regions that exposed him to a wide cross section of people. That varied background supplied the raw material he now draws on in books and talks.

Voice and Narrative Style

Conversational Clarity

Penzey favors plain language and direct examples, which makes complex political and cultural ideas feel accessible rather than academic. His style aims to invite readers into the conversation instead of speaking at them.

Blending Personal and Political

His work consistently ties individual stories to broader systems, showing how kitchen table worries connect to voting behavior, media coverage, and policy outcomes. This linkage helps audiences see their own experiences reflected in larger trends.

Books and Public Appearances

Literary Work and Themes

Through a mix of essays, memoirs, and cultural commentary, Penzey examines topics like trust, power, and local loyalty. These books function as both personal records and snapshots of national mood at specific moments.

Live Events and Audience Interaction

On tour, he treats each venue as a listening session, encouraging audience participation and weaving crowd reactions into the narrative. This live layer adds unpredictability and keeps the material closely aligned with current sentiment.

Cultural Impact and Political Discourse

Framing Everyday Politics

By highlighting stories from diners, gas stations, and local gatherings, Penzey reframes politics as a series of human interactions rather than an exclusively institutional process. This perspective can shift how readers interpret news and campaign messaging.

Influence on Listeners and Readers

For audiences who feel overlooked by traditional media, his work offers a sense of recognition and voice. The emphasis on everyday Americans can encourage more nuanced conversations in communities and online forums.
